Vini Jr. sorry for red card in Madrid comeback win
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ter
How does this make you feel?



Real Madrid secured a 2-1 comeback victory over Valencia in the first LaLiga game of 2025, with Vinícius Júnior being sent off for striking Valencia’s goalkeeper before Luka Modric and Jude Bellingham scored to secure the win. Coach Carlo Ancelotti defended Vinícius’ dismissal, expressing frustration over missed penalties and praising Bellingham’s performance, as Madrid now lead LaLiga ahead of Atlético Madrid. Vinícius’ red card marked his second dismissal at Mestalla, with Ancelotti planning to appeal the decision and emphasizing the player’s importance to the team.
